About
Catfish Deweys is a seafood restaurant located in Fort Lauderdale, Florida. This restaurant provides patrons with seafood dishes made from some of the freshest products available in the area and their menu consists of an array of delicious options to choose from. The restaurant also has excellent customer service and its inviting atmosphere makes it the perfect place to enjoy a meal with friends and family.

Must Try Dishes
When in Catfish Deweys in Fort Lauderdale, Florida, make sure to try their widely acclaimed All-You-Can-Eat Catfish. For seafood lovers, the Alaskan Snow Crab Legs is a must. Another popular dish is their St. Louis Style Ribs known for its tender meat that easily falls off the bone. Don't miss their unique and flavorful Shrimp and Crawfish Étouffée. And to truly complete your dining experience, always pair your meal with their homemade Key Lime Pie.
